You know this movie is going to feature some sexy, cute and fun scenes when we have the likes of Drew Barrymore, Cameron Diaz and Lucy Liu teaming up. These ultra-confident actresses play Dylan, Natalie, and Alex, respectively, the super sly detectives known as Charlie’s Angels. I can’t forget about Bill Murray who plays Bosley. He makes me smile. The movie is an adaptation of the 70’s television hit of the same name but the plot has been stepped up a new notches.
Behind these strong women are, arguably, strong men. Keep in mind that these nearly superhero-like women still have a soft side. We are introduced to Barrymore waking up with her real-life love interest (at the time) Tom Green who plays “The Chad”. Liu is dating “Joey” from Friends, Matt LeBlanc who plays an actor. He’s really expanded his repertoire in this one! And then we have Diaz who meets her guy Pete while undercover. He’s played by Luke Wilson back before his more famous role in Old School (2002).
